Why “Home Value” Is Often About Perception Before It Is About Numbers

Appraisals matter, but real buyers decide emotionally first. Before they analyze comps, they react to how the home looks and feels.

Exterior Cleanliness Impacts Buyer Psychology

A clean exterior creates these impressions:

  • The home has been maintained consistently
  • Repairs have likely been addressed on time
  • The property is easier to own and maintain
  • The seller cares about details

A dirty exterior can create the opposite impression:

  • Deferred maintenance
  • Moisture problems
  • Hidden damage behind stains
  • Higher ownership cost after purchase

Even if none of those concerns are true, stains and grime can trigger them. Pressure washing removes those negative signals and replaces them with visible evidence of care.

Driveways And Walkways: The Highest Visual Return For The Lowest Effort

Your driveway is typically one of the largest visible surfaces on the property. If it is dark, stained, or striped with traffic lanes, it pulls down the entire look of the home.

How Clean Concrete Increases Perceived Value

  • The home looks brighter and more updated
  • Entry feels safer and more welcoming
  • Listing photos look sharper and more vibrant
  • Buyers assume fewer maintenance headaches

It also improves real usability. Algae buildup can make concrete slippery, and buyers feel that risk when walking up.

A clean driveway and walkway can create an immediate “this home is cared for” impression, which supports stronger offers.

Roof Stains Can Reduce Perceived Value More Than Sellers Realize

Black streaks and roof staining are one of the fastest ways to make a home look older. Buyers often assume roof stains mean roof failure, even when the roof has plenty of life left.

Why Roof Appearance Impacts Negotiation

  • Buyers assume replacement costs
  • Buyers ask for credits or price reductions
  • Buyers become more cautious during inspections
  • The home looks less appealing in online photos

DIY Mistakes Can Reduce Value Instead Of Increasing It

DIY pressure washing can be tempting, but it can backfire and actually harm value if damage occurs.

Common DIY Mistakes That Hurt Home Value

  • Etching concrete and leaving permanent striping
  • Damaging siding or forcing water behind panels
  • Splintering wood fences and decks
  • Blasting paver joint sand out and causing shifting
  • Breaking screens or spraying water into window seals

The Best Time To Pressure Wash For Value Impact

Timing depends on your goals. If you are selling, you want the home looking fresh through photos and early showings.

Best Practice Timeline For Sellers

  • Pressure wash 2 to 4 weeks before listing photos
  • Leave weather buffer for rescheduling
  • Clean before new mulch or landscaping refresh if possible
  • Touch up high traffic concrete if listing lasts longer

Frequently Asked Questions About Pressure Washing And Home Value

Does Pressure Washing Really Increase Home Value?

It increases perceived value by improving curb appeal and reducing buyer objections. It can also support better listing performance and stronger offers.

What Should I Clean First For The Biggest Value Boost?

Start with the driveway, sidewalks, and front entry. Then address siding and roof stains if they are visible from the street.

Is Roof Cleaning Worth It Before Selling?

If roof staining is visible, roof soft washing can dramatically improve perception and reduce negotiation pressure related to roof appearance.

How Long Do Pressure Washing Results Last?

Results vary by shade and weather. Many surfaces stay noticeably cleaner for weeks to months, while algae prone areas may need routine maintenance.
